Position Summary:
This position is for a Transmission SCADA Engineer to primarily address Remote Engineering Access (Subnet - Power System Center) upkeep and associated modeling and data quality backlog.
Additional areas of focus for this role will be:
* Support the field with RTU/SCADA configurations across the Midwest
* RTU-specific compliance activities (Baseline Updates, Tripwire Testing, etc.)
* Communication and data-sharing standards and support with Interties
* Support non-protection based devices such as Electronic Temperature Monitors (ETMs), LTC/VR Controllers, DGAs, and Carrier.
